預計到 2032 年光纖市場規模將成長至 871.9 億美元,複合年成長率為 12.03%。

主要市場統計數據
基準年2024年 351.3億美元
預計2025年 393.6億美元
預測年份:2032年 871.9億美元
複合年成長率(%) 12.03%

有針對性的細分洞察揭示了技術格式、安裝環境和最終用戶需求如何影響採購和部署選擇

按技術和應用細分光纖市場,可以揭示差異化的需求促進因素和採購重點,有助於產品選擇和部署規劃。依模式分析著重於多模光纖和單模光纖,每種光纖適用於不同的距離和頻寬配置。這種差異會影響連接器的選擇、收發器相容性和鏈路預算。產品類型包括鬆套管、微型、帶狀、單元和緊緩衝設計,選擇時需考慮佈線限制、連接方法以及機械保護需求等因素。

芯數分析考慮了從2芯到4芯等高密度格式的各種選項,從6芯到12芯的配置,以及12芯或以上的部署,這些選項會影響電纜直徑、佈線策略和未來的擴展容量。安裝類型包括架空、海底和地下安裝,每種安裝都有各自的環境暴露、保護要求和維護訪問挑戰。應用主導的細分區分資料中心、工業和電訊/資料通訊,每種應用對效能和可靠性的期望不同,必須與系統結構相符。

從最終用戶的觀點來看,企業、政府和國防、通訊業者以及公共產業各自都有不同的採購週期、合規性約束和生命週期優先順序。了解這些細分領域的相互關聯,有助於更有針對性地開發產品、提供差異化的服務,並明確合格和測試活動的優先級,以滿足每個相關人員群體的特定需求。

區域發展動態和策略要務將決定供應商和網路營運商如何在全球市場上協調其技術解決方案和商業性方法

區域動態將影響技術採用模式、供應商策略和部署優先級,這需要區域理解和差異化的商業性方法。在美洲,部署重點是城域和城際骨幹網路的快速擴張,以及資料中心連接方面的投資增加,從而推動了對更高核心數量和靈活部署的需求。該地區也高度重視法規合規性和效能保證,以支援關鍵的企業和通訊業者網路。

歐洲、中東和非洲地區的基礎設施成熟度和投資週期各不相同,需求範圍廣泛,從升級改造傳統城域網路到建造遠距海底和跨境鏈路,不一而足。在該地區營運的供應商必須平衡標準並與當地法規結構協調一致,同時提供針對氣候和地形等各種挑戰的客製化解決方案。同時,在亞太地區,下一代網路架構的積極採用、大規模資料中心的擴建以及高密度城市發展,對高密度帶狀和微型電纜解決方案的需求強勁,需要加快認證流程以滿足部署計畫。

因此,有效的區域策略應將全球產品藍圖與本地技術支援、強大的庫存管理以及能夠加快許可和安裝的夥伴關係關係相結合。根據本地部署實際情況和法規環境客製化產品的公司將在獲得多個計劃合約和長期服務關係方面佔據優勢。

The Fiber Optic Market is projected to grow by USD 87.19 billion at a CAGR of 12.03% by 2032.

KEY MARKET STATISTICS
Base Year [2024] USD 35.13 billion
Estimated Year [2025] USD 39.36 billion
Forecast Year [2032] USD 87.19 billion
CAGR (%) 12.03%

Targeted segmentation insights revealing how technical formats installation environments and end user requirements converge to shape procurement and deployment choices

Segmenting the fiber optic market along technical and application axes reveals differentiated demand drivers and procurement priorities that inform product selection and deployment planning. Analysis by mode focuses on Multi Mode versus Single Mode fibers, with each catering to distinct distance and bandwidth profiles; this differentiation influences connector selection, transceiver compatibility, and link budgeting. Product type segmentation encompasses Loose Tube, Micro, Ribbon, Single Unit, and Tight Buffered designs, and those choices are guided by considerations such as pathway constraints, splicing practices, and mechanical protection needs.

Core count analysis examines options spanning two core builds to higher density formats such as four cores, configurations in the range of six to twelve cores, and arrangements above twelve cores, which affect cable diameter, routing strategies, and future expansion capacity. Installation type considerations include aerial, submarine, and underground deployments, each presenting unique environmental exposures, protection requirements, and maintenance access challenges. Application driven segmentation differentiates data center, industrial, and telecom and datacom contexts, each with distinct performance and reliability expectations that must be matched to system architecture.

From an end user perspective, enterprise, government and defense, telecom operators, and utilities each bring different procurement cycles, compliance constraints, and lifecycle priorities. Understanding how these segments intersect enables more targeted product development, differentiated service offerings, and clearer prioritization of qualification and testing activities to meet the specific needs of each stakeholder group.

Regional deployment dynamics and strategic imperatives that determine how suppliers and network operators tailor technical solutions and commercial approaches across global markets

Regional dynamics influence technology adoption patterns, supplier strategies, and deployment priorities in ways that require localized understanding and differentiated commercial approaches. In the Americas, deployments emphasize rapid expansion of metropolitan and intercity backbones coupled with increasing investment in data center connectivity, which elevates demand for higher core counts and flexible installation formats. This region also shows a strong focus on regulatory compliance and performance assurances to support critical enterprise and carrier networks.

Across Europe, Middle East and Africa, there is a broad diversity of infrastructure maturity and investment cycles that drives a wide spectrum of requirements, from modernizing legacy urban networks to constructing long distance submarine and cross border links. Suppliers operating in this geography must balance standards harmonization with local regulatory frameworks while offering solutions tailored to varied climatic and terrain challenges. Meanwhile in the Asia Pacific region, vigorous adoption of next generation network architectures, large scale data center expansions, and dense urban rollouts create intense demand for high density ribbon and micro cable solutions and for rapid qualification processes to keep pace with deployment timelines.

Effective regional strategies therefore combine global product roadmaps with localized technical support, robust inventory management, and partnerships that accelerate permitting and installation. Companies that calibrate offerings to regional deployment realities and regulatory environments will be advantaged in securing multi project engagements and long term service relationships.
